Does Lake Corpus Christi water damage my plumbing fixtures?

Water from Lake Corpus Christi contains high mineral content that causes scaling throughout your plumbing system. This hard water leaves deposits inside water heaters, reducing efficiency and shortening their lifespan. Fixtures develop reduced flow as mineral buildup accumulates in aerators and valve seats. Regular descaling maintenance helps mitigate these effects.

Why do my copper pipes keep springing leaks?

Copper pipes from 1983 installations often develop pinhole leaks due to decades of water flow and mineral buildup. The copper thins at specific points, creating tiny failures that worsen over time. Joint calcification also occurs where fittings meet, compromising the original solder connections. These issues typically manifest after 40+ years of service.

Are there special plumbing considerations for rural Orange Grove homes?

Rural properties often rely on well systems and septic tanks rather than municipal connections. Well pumps require regular maintenance to handle hard water conditions common here. Septic systems need proper sizing and periodic pumping to function effectively. These systems operate independently from city infrastructure, requiring specialized knowledge for repairs and maintenance.

Could the flat land around Orange Grove affect my main sewer line?

The plain terrain around Coastal Bend College creates minimal natural drainage slope, which can lead to standing water putting pressure on main lines. Soil saturation from poor drainage adds stress to underground pipes and their connections. Without proper grading, water pools around foundation lines, increasing corrosion risk. Proper drainage planning accounts for these flatland conditions.
